Output e4c70600465270bea650c123396c99030b9e5e8b198c900c736594c14de48ee9:1

value
11788350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e42f38c69af51809c86f5d3677c695346efdc10 OP_EQUAL
address
3QsRm8YKBYTUqy7Ejx7ZbF62W1MpjhU7fE
transaction
e4c70600465270bea650c123396c99030b9e5e8b198c900c736594c14de48ee9
spent
true